1963 Ferrari 250 GTO vs. 1976 Ford Capri

To start off, 1976 Ford Capri is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O would be higher. At 2,953 cc (12 cylinders), 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O (300 HP) has 251 more horse power than 1976 Ford Capri. (49 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O should accelerate faster than 1976 Ford Capri.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1976 Ford Capri weights approximately 60 kg more than 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O (294 Nm @ 5500 RPM) has 208 more torque (in Nm) than 1976 Ford Capri. (86 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1976 Ford Capri.

Compare all specifications:

1963 Ferrari 250 GTO 1976 Ford Capri
Make Ferrari Ford
Model 250 GTO Capri
Year Released 1963 1976
Body Type Coupe Coupe
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2953 cc 1298 cc
Engine Cylinders 12 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 300 HP 49 HP
Torque 294 Nm 86 Nm
Torque RPM 5500 RPM 3000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 2 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 950 kg 1010 kg
Vehicle Length 4410 mm 4300 mm
Vehicle Width 1680 mm 1710 mm
Vehicle Height 1230 mm 1370 mm
Wheelbase Size 2410 mm 2570 mm
